The position requires proven experience in security architectures and related systems for securing networks, systems and information in a complex and evolving computing environment. Security architecture encompasses a broad range of technologies from on-premise to cloud platforms including communications, storage, identity management and web, as well as analytic and modeling applications.

Must possess strong management skills along with an understanding of current and emerging technologies. Manages a group of security engineers responsible for RAND security systems operations. Evaluates secure solutions based on approved security architectures.

Analyzes business impact and exposure based on emerging security threats, vulnerabilities, and risks. Works closely with enterprise architects, other functional area architects and security specialists to ensure security solutions adequately mitigate identified risks and meet business objectives and regulatory requirements; researches, designs and advocates new technologies, architectures, and security products that will support evolving security requirements for the enterprise.

Serves as a security expert in network design, system integration and application development efforts, helping project teams comply with enterprise and IT security policies, standards, and operation requirements

as well as federal regulations and industry best practices.

Contributes to the development of the information security strategy and annual updates to the information security roadmap. Oversees the delivery of the business, information and technical artifacts that constitute the enterprise information security architecture and solutions. Contributes to the alignment of security governance and policies with Enterprise Architecture governance and Information Services project methodology. Other duties as assigned. Qualifications Must have demonstrated experience in developing architecture solutions for security systems, applications, and infrastructure in a large, complex IT environment.

Must have a minimum of 3 years of supervisory experience. Must be able to extract complete business requirements for a given solution space by means of a consistent rigorous process. Must be able to effectively describe security requirements and complex technologies to lay people, describing risks and benefits and expected outcomes. Must be able to create network architecture, data flow and business process diagrams using Microsoft Visio or compatible tool. Strong conceptual thinking and communication skills — the ability to conceptualize complex business and technical requirements into comprehensible architectures and designs.

Team-oriented interpersonal skills, with the ability to interface effectively with a broad range of people and roles, including vendors and IT and business personnel. Demonstrable written and verbal communication skills. Seven to 10+ years of combined IT and security architecture/engineering experience with a broad exposure to infrastructure/network and multiplatform environments. Minimum 4 years’ experience in security architecture or security engineering roles. Experience working in virtual environments as well as public and private cloud environments.

Knowledge of a security-specific architecture methodology (for example, SABSA). Knowledge of cloud security frameworks and zero trust architecture. Education BA/BS Degree strongly preferred or equivalent experience Security Clearance The ability to obtain and maintain a Secret Security Clearance within a reasonable amount of time. Pay Range $142,000- $211,500 RAND considers a variety of factors when formulating an offer, including but not limited to, the specific role and associated responsibilities; a candidate’s work experience, education/training, skills, expertise; and internal equity.

 Successful candidates will be offered employment in a specific title, as determined by the candidate's education and experience. The salary range includes base pay plus RAND’s sabbatic pay (which provides additional compensation above base pay when vacation is taken). In addition, RAND provides strong benefits including health insurance coverage, life and disability insurance, savings plan, paid time-off and more. Location Santa Monica, Washington D.
